Here is my first card made with this set. I love how easy two step stamping is with clear stamps. Makes lining them up a breeze.
The card base is a 4 1/4″x 8 1/2″ piece of Really Rust cardstock folded in half.
The black scallop square is made with Nestabilities.
The white layer is a 3 1/2″ square of Shimmery White cardstock. The roses were stamped with
1. Layer Apricot Appeal
2. Layer Pumpkin Pie stamped off once
3. Layer Pumpkin Pie
4. Layer Real Rust
The stem and flowers were stamped with Certainly Celery and Wild Wasabi.
The ribbon is May Arts ribbon, the small scallop circle was cut with decorative scissors.
